Ingredients

#Main Dough (Enough for 6 pieces):to taste
High-gluten Flour300g
Cheese Powder20g
Milk220g
Egg Yolk1 piece
Sugar20g
Yeast4g
Salt4g
Butter20g
#Garlic Butter:to taste
Butter50g
Garlic Paste15g
Salt1.5g
Chopped Parsley2g
#Cheese Sauce:to taste
Cream Cheese60g
Powdered Sugar5g
RumAdd as needed

Steps

1

Start by making the main dough: Add all ingredients except butter into the mixer.

2

Mix at low speed until the ingredients are uniform, then at medium-high speed until a rough membrane forms.

3

Add 20g butter and continue mixing until fully developed.

4

Shape the completed dough into a ball and place it in a fermentation box. Let it proof at room temperature for 1 hour. Test by pressing a finger into it; if it doesn't spring back, it's ready.

5

Remove the proofed dough and deflate. Divide into 6 portions.

6

Shape into balls and let rest for 10-15 minutes.

7

Flatten with a rolling pin to form an oval shape.

8

Fold both sides toward the center line, then fold again and seal tight.

9

After shaping, spray a little water on the surface, coat with cheese powder, and proof in a 35°C oven for 30-40 minutes.

10

While proofing, prepare the garlic butter: Soften 50g butter, then mix with 15g garlic paste, 1.5g salt, and 2g chopped parsley. Place in a piping bag. (You'll have leftovers, which can be used in cooking!)

11

Next, make the cheese sauce for the center: Mix 60g softened cream cheese with 5g powdered sugar. Blend in rum as needed. (Rum can be omitted.)

12

After proofing, score the dough with a blade and pipe in garlic butter.

13

Bake in a preheated oven at 180°C for 15-18 minutes. Monitor color change.

14

After cooling, cut a slit in the middle and pipe in cheese sauce.
